Dedicated Server Rental

A dedicated server is a physical machine consisting of tangible hardware that runs an operating system. It is commonly used to host websites, databases, email services, and game servers. Located in a data center, it is a hardware-based computing system designed to meet the IT needs of businesses and organizations. Each dedicated server comes with its own processor, memory, storage, and other components.

How Does a Dedicated Server Work?

Dedicated servers are hosted in data centers or on-premise server rooms. They typically serve multiple users or clients through network access. Each server comes with a pre-installed operating system and can host various applications and services. Users access the server via network connections using web browsers or terminal tools such as SSH.

What Are the Differences Between Virtual Servers and Dedicated Servers?

Virtual servers are created by virtualizing physical servers, while dedicated servers run directly on physical hardware. Some of the key differences between these two server types include:

Feature

Virtual Server Dedicated Server

Hardware Sharing

Multiple virtual servers run on a single physical server.

Each server is allocated dedicated hardware.

Performance

Offers lower performance compared to dedicated servers.

Provides higher performance and processing power.

Security

The virtualization layer may introduce additional security risks.

Offers higher security and greater control.

Cost

More cost-effective.

More expensive.

A dedicated server is a powerful computer used to host websites, databases, email servers, and many other applications. Unlike virtual servers, dedicated servers have their own exclusive hardware and do not share resources with other users.

This provides greater control, performance, and flexibility. Dedicated server hardware typically consists of the following core components:

• Motherboard

• Processor (CPU)

• Memory (RAM)

• Storage

• Network Adapter

• Power Supply

Dedicated servers are compatible with various processor architectures (x86, ARM, PowerPC, etc.) and operating systems such as Windows Server, Linux distributions, and others. When making a selection, it is important to evaluate the intended use of the server and the required resources.

Hardware specifications and application requirements play a key role in determining which operating system should be chosen.

Dedicated server backup and recovery processes ensure that server data can be restored in case of data loss or hardware failure. There are different backup methods available, with the most common being:

• Full backup

• Incremental backup

• Differential backup

Backups can be stored on local storage devices or remote locations such as cloud storage. The recovery process varies depending on the backup type and the method used.

Dedicated server security involves a set of measures designed to prevent unauthorized access, misuse, modification, or destruction of server data. To improve server security, you can take the following steps:

• Use strong passwords and authentication methods.

• Keep server software up to date.

• Use firewall and antivirus solutions.

• Monitor and control login and access activities.

• Create a reliable data backup and recovery plan.
